Modern industrial compound design relies heavily on organofunctional silanes (represented generically as Y-R-Si(OR')₃). The organic group 'Y' (such as amino, epoxy, vinyl, or mercapto) chemical bonds with matching organic resins, while the hydrolyzable alkoxy group 'OR' (typically methoxy or ethoxy) reacts with inorganic filler surfaces (such as silica, glass fiber, or metal oxides). This dual-reactivity mechanism significantly enhances interfacial adhesion and structural integrity.
By establishing strong chemical bridges across dissimilar interfaces, silanes improve flexural strength, tensile properties, and impact resistance in reinforced plastics, sealants, and composite materials.
Under humid tropical conditions like those found in Bangkok, untreated polymers can suffer from moisture-induced delamination. Silanes build crosslinked networks that block moisture ingress and corrosion.
In highly filled compounds (such as silica-filled rubber or mineral-filled plastics), silanes lower system viscosity, prevent filler agglomeration, and optimize resin flow properties during processing.
On a global scale, the demand for silanes is driven by the rise of green tires (requiring sulfur-functionalized silanes like bis-triethoxysilylpropyl disulfide), low-VOC coatings, and high-purity encapsulation materials for the semiconductor and electronics industries.
